MUCINO-MARQUEZ, ROCÍO ELIZABETH; FIGUEROA-TORRES, ARÍA GUADALUPE  e  AGUIRRE-LEON, ARTURO. Phytoplankton Composition in the Fluvial-lagoon Systems Pom-Atasta and Palizada del Este, Adjacent to the Terminos Lagoon Campeche, México. Acta biol.Colomb. [online]. 2014, vol.19, n.1, pp.63-84. ISSN 0120-548X.  https://doi.org/10.15446/abc.v19n1.38032.

The composition and abundance of phytoplankton community, and its relation to physical and chemical factors was evaluated in the fluvial-lagoon systems Pom-Atasta (PA) and Palizada del Este (PE), in February, 2011. Water samples were collected in ten sampling sites in each lagoon, with a van Dorn bottle at the surface and in the middle of the water column to measure temperature, salinity, dissolved oxygen, inorganic nutrients, chlorophyll a and the composition and abundance of phytoplankton. In order to describe the behavior of phytoplankton it was calculated species abundance, Shannon-Wiener diversity and Pielou equitability indices were used, and to analyze the relationship between the abundance of phytoplankton species and environmental variables, a canonical correspondence analysis (CCA) was applied. The results showed that PE was the lagoon that presented a great biodiversity with 348 identified taxa, maximum abundance values (269 x103 103 cells L-1), H' (3.2) and J' (0.95). Cylindrotheca closterium was the most abundant species in both systems, observing the highest abundance (52.5 x103 103 célls L-1) in PA, forming incipient toxic algal blooms. It should be noted that salinity was the most influential environmental variable in the composition and abundance of phytoplankton.

Palavras-chave : Gulf of Mexico; lagoon systems; phytoplankton; Terminos Lagoon.
